数据采样是数据分析过程中一个至关重要的步骤,它可以帮助我们从大量的数据中抽取有代表性的样本,以便进行更高效的后续分析。对于初学者来说,掌握高效的数据采样技巧对于提升数据分析效率至关重要。下面,我们将深入探讨如何构建一个框架来轻松提升数据分析效率。
一、了解数据采样
1.1 什么是数据采样?
数据采样是从整个数据集中选择一部分数据进行分析的方法。通过采样,我们可以减少数据处理的复杂性和计算成本,同时仍然保持分析的准确性和有效性。
1.2 数据采样的类型
- 随机采样:每个数据点被选中的概率相等。
- 分层采样:将数据集划分为几个层次,从每个层次中独立采样。
- 系统采样:按照一定的规律或间隔从数据集中选择样本。
二、构建数据采样框架
2.1 确定采样目标
在进行数据采样之前,首先要明确采样目标。例如,是为了进行预测、聚类还是其他目的。
2.2 选择合适的采样方法
根据采样目标和数据特征,选择合适的采样方法。例如,对于大数据集,可以选择随机采样或系统采样;对于具有明显层次结构的数据,可以选择分层采样。
2.3 评估样本代表性
在采样过程中,要确保样本具有代表性,避免偏差。可以通过以下方法评估样本代表性:
- 描述性统计:计算样本的均值、方差、标准差等指标,与总体指标进行比较。
- 图表分析:绘制样本的分布图,与总体分布图进行比较。
2.4 使用采样工具
市面上有许多采样工具可以帮助我们高效地进行数据采样,如R语言的sampling包、Python的pandas库等。
三、提升数据分析效率
3.1 减少数据量
通过数据采样,我们可以减少需要处理的数据量,从而降低计算成本和时间。
3.2 提高分析速度
采样后的数据量减少,可以加快分析速度,提高工作效率。
3.3 增强结果的可解释性
通过合理的数据采样,可以增强分析结果的可解释性,使结果更加直观。
四、案例分析
假设我们要分析一个包含1000万条用户数据的社交媒体平台,目的是了解用户行为。在这种情况下,我们可以采用以下步骤:
- 确定采样目标:了解用户行为。
- 选择采样方法:随机采样。
- 评估样本代表性:计算样本的描述性统计指标,与总体指标进行比较。
- 使用采样工具:Python的
pandas库。 - 进行数据分析:根据采样后的数据,分析用户行为,如用户活跃度、发布内容类型等。
通过以上步骤,我们可以轻松地从大量数据中抽取有代表性的样本,进行高效的数据分析。
五、总结
高效的数据采样对于提升数据分析效率至关重要。通过构建一个合理的框架,我们可以更好地选择采样方法、评估样本代表性,并最终提高数据分析效率。希望本文能帮助你更好地掌握数据采样技巧,为你的数据分析之路助力。
